Tips for Navigating the Journey of Loss
This section offers practical tips to help individuals and families navigate the challenging journey of loss and grief. By following these guidelines, you can find comfort, support, and strength during this difficult time.
Tip 1: Allow Yourself to Grieve:
Acknowledge and embrace your emotions, whether it’s sadness, anger, or confusion. Grieving is a natural process, and there is no right or wrong way to do so.Tip 2: Seek Support from Loved Ones and Friends:
Reach out to your support network of family and friends. Talking about your feelings and experiences can provide comfort and validation.Tip 3: Consider Professional Counseling or Therapy:
If you find it difficult to cope with your grief, seeking professional help from a therapist or counselor can offer valuable support and guidance.Tip 4: Create a Meaningful Tribute:
Whether it’s a memorial service, a gathering of loved ones, or a personalized tribute, find ways to honor the memory of your loved one and celebrate their life.Tip 5: Take Care of Your Physical and Mental Health:
Prioritize self-care by getting enough rest, eating balanced meals, and engaging in activities that promote your well-being. Exercise, meditation, and spending time in nature can be beneficial.Tip 6: Allow Time for Healing:
Grief is a journey, not a destination. Be patient with yourself and allow time for healing. Remember that everyone grieves differently and at their own pace.Tip 7: Seek Grief Support Groups or Online Forums:
Connecting with others who have experienced similar losses can provide a sense of community and understanding. Support groups and online forums offer a safe space to share your experiences and learn from others.
These tips can help you navigate the journey of loss and find comfort and support during this challenging time. Remember that grief is a natural process, and it’s important to allow yourself to heal at your own pace.
